FERRAMENTAS LINUX: Um ano depois, código de falha de página especulativo foi revisado para possíveis benefícios de desempenho

quarta-feira, 17 de abril de 2019

Um ano depois, código de falha de página especulativo foi revisado para possíveis benefícios de desempenho




Confira !!



Já se passou quase um ano desde que a série de patches anterior, trabalhando em falhas de páginas especulativas para o kernel Linux, foi enviada para revisão. Felizmente, o Laurent Dufour da IBM atualizou mais uma vez esses patches contra o código mais recente e os enviou para a mais nova rodada de discussões.

O resumo simples é o conjunto de 31 patches do kernel que podem melhorar a simultaneidade de processos altamente segmentados. A melhoria vem lidando com falhas de página do espaço do usuário sem manter o semáforo mmap e, por sua vez, eliminando algumas esperas no manipulador de falhas da página.

Ao usar um "produto de banco de dados multi-threaded popular na memória", a IBM encontrou o desempenho do Linux com revisões anteriores desses patches aumentando em até 30% em transações por segundo. Eles ainda estão testando esses novos patches "v12", mas esperam um resultado semelhante.

Mais detalhes através desta mensagem de patch . Assumindo que os benefícios de desempenho sejam bem-sucedidos, esperamos que não demore mais um ano para ver a próxima rodada de revisões ou encontrar o código principal no kernel do Linux.


Fonte

Até a próxima !!

Nenhum comentário:

Postar um comentário